The Real Fountain of Youth! Nope, it’s not exercise…

A 20-year study published in the journal Science concluded that cutting calories by up to 30% can slow-down the aging process, improve brain function, and help you live longer.
The only catch in the study is that it was done on rhesus monkeys.
